  • Inspected provides a technology platform that helps construction contractors manage permitting and inspections with greater speed and visibility. Through its Permit Hub software and virtual inspection services, the company centralizes workflows, reduces approval delays and helps contractors complete projects faster while maintaining regulatory compliance.

  • ShareMyToolbox is redefining construction tool tracking by providing a simple, mobile-first platform that improves tool visibility, accountability, and project efficiency. With features like real-time tracking and preventive maintenance management, it helps teams work smarter and reduce costs across industries.

  • With user-configurable automations, AI, and data-driven intelligence, BuyMetrics® is reshaping lumber procurement, bringing new transparency to the market, creating new opportunity for the buyers of lumber and other volatile commodities. BuyMetrics market-proven technologies allow the buyer to advantageously configure a transaction, automate the collection and evaluation of vendor offers, quickly make informed purchase decisions, measure performance, and hone strategy. With over 25 years of innovation, BuyMetrics is leveling the buy/sell playing field, empowering lumber buyers, making the construction supply-chain more efficient for the buyers and sellers of forest products.

  • Miter, a cloud-based platform designed specifically for contractors, brings HR, time tracking, payroll, compliance, benefits and job costing into a single, connected system. For office teams, what once required toggling between three or more systems now flows through one.

  • Command Alkon modernizes heavy materials operations with a cloud-based technology platform that connects production, dispatch, logistics, ticketing and payments. By unifying data and automating workflows, it reduces manual steps and supports real-time decision-making, helping producers lower costs and deliver more consistent service across ready-mix, aggregate and asphalt sectors.

  • JobNimbus is a cloud-based project management and CRM software designed for contractors and home service businesses. It streamlines workflows, enhances communication, and improves efficiency through job tracking, automation, and integrations with industry-leading tools. Users can manage leads, schedule appointments, track projects and generate invoices from a single, user-friendly platform.

  • PRINT3D Technologies 3D prints homes and manufactures 3D home printers. It redesigned the 3D home printing machine, focusing on refining the quality of the entire system, and patented the new design. It is set to be the premier builder of homes and distributor of 3D home printers.
